Dantardi

Dantardi is a village located in Salumbar tehsil of Udaipur district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Salumbar (tehsildar office) and 88km away from district headquarter Udaipur. As per 2009 stats, Kaduni is the gram panchayat of Dantardi village.

About Dantardi

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dantardi is 107121. The village spans a total geographical area of 293 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 313027. Salumber is nearest town to Dantardi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Dantardi

Below is a concise population overview of Dantardi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,410 682 728
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 278 131 147
Scheduled Castes (SC) 36 15 21
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,299 627 672
Literate Population 527 329 198
Illiterate Population 883 353 530

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dantardi village:

  • The total population of Dantardi village is around 1,410, including approximately 682 males and 728 females, with a sex ratio of 1067 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 278 children aged 0–6 years in Dantardi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Dantardi village has 36 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1,299 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Dantardi village is about 37.38%, with male literacy at 48.24% and female literacy at 27.20%.
  • There are around 264 households in Dantardi village.

Connectivity of Dantardi

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dantardi. As per the 2011 stats, Dantardi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
